Output 71f8f324c94e72b5ad2ffed1454d36960f149f39b4e5c95fced6ecaab76a90b1:0

value
24890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a3cc11297c922f8471e320d7c3579dcb4b1905f OP_EQUAL
address
32d9Tji8Kuzso42VXhs9sco1dEQAqikdpd
transaction
71f8f324c94e72b5ad2ffed1454d36960f149f39b4e5c95fced6ecaab76a90b1
spent
true